The first and most important aspect of golf turf design is the quality of the grass. The type of grass used on a golf course can greatly affect the playability of the course. Different types of grass have different characteristics, such as texture, density, and resilience. For example, Bermuda grass is known for its ability to withstand high temperatures and heavy foot traffic, making it a popular choice for golf courses in warmer climates. On the other hand, Bentgrass is known for its fine texture and ability to provide a smooth putting surface. The choice of grass should be based on the climate, soil conditions, and the desired playing experience.
In addition to the type of grass, the maintenance practices employed on the golf turf also play a crucial role in its design. Regular mowing, watering, fertilizing, and aerating are all essential for maintaining healthy turf. Mowing at the correct height ensures that the grass remains at an optimal length for play, while watering and fertilizing provide the necessary nutrients for growth and recovery. Aerating the turf helps to alleviate compaction and improve water and nutrient penetration. These maintenance practices should be carried out regularly to ensure that the golf turf remains in top condition.

One of the most important factors to consider when designing a golf turf is the climate of the area. Different grass species thrive in different climates, so it is essential to choose a grass variety that is well-suited to the local climate. For example, warm-season grasses like Bermuda grass and Zoysia grass are ideal for hot and humid climates, while cool-season grasses like Kentucky bluegrass and fescue are better suited to cooler climates. By selecting the right grass species, golf course designers can ensure that the turf remains healthy and vibrant throughout the year.
Another key factor to consider is the type of soil in the area. Different grass species have different soil requirements, so it is important to choose a grass variety that can thrive in the local soil conditions. For example, sandy soils drain quickly and require grass varieties that can tolerate drought and poor nutrient availability. On the other hand, clay soils retain water and require grass varieties that can withstand wet conditions. By understanding the soil type and its characteristics, golf course designers can select the most suitable grass species for the area.
Maintenance requirements are also an important consideration when designing a golf turf. Some grass varieties require more frequent mowing, fertilizing, and watering than others. It is important to choose a grass variety that matches the maintenance capabilities of the golf course. For example, if the golf course has limited resources for maintenance, it may be more practical to choose a low-maintenance grass variety that requires less frequent care. By selecting a grass variety that aligns with the maintenance capabilities of the golf course, designers can ensure that the turf remains healthy and well-maintained.

In addition to selecting the right grass species, golf turf designers also utilize advanced irrigation systems to maintain the health and appearance of the turf. These systems are designed to deliver water efficiently and evenly across the course, ensuring that the grass receives the right amount of moisture. By using sensors and weather data, these systems can adjust the irrigation schedule based on the specific needs of the turf, conserving water and reducing waste.
Another innovative technique in golf turf design is the use of sand-based root zones. These root zones consist of a mixture of sand and organic matter, which provides excellent drainage and promotes healthy root growth. This allows the turf to withstand heavy rainfall and prevents water from pooling on the surface, ensuring that the course remains playable even after a downpour.
